What is Mental Health and Wellness?
According to the World Health Organization, "mental health is a state of well-being in which the individual realizes his or her own abilities, can cope with the normal stresses of life, can work productively and fruitfully, and is able to make a contribution to his or her community."
Why is Mental Health and Wellness Counseling Important?
Mental Health and Wellness Counseling is important because a professional counselor can offer a safe space to talk about problems a person is experiencing. Counseling provides an opportunity for personal goal setting, support, and problem solving skills that stem from physical, emotional, and spiritual struggles.
